Question about Teams for Mobile

Does anyone know if we can access our work Teams on the mobile app? I haven’t even tried to see if it was possible, and I wasn’t sure if that would be a big no no, however I know Teams doesn’t require VPN access.

Depends on the department. Some only allow you to log into Teams from a work-issued device, while others you can log in from any device.

Each department is different. We recently went through an M365 deployment within the organization I work for. Do you know if your organization has allowed access to M365 resources such as email from a personal device? If so, you may have access to Teams.

If they haven’t permitted it from personal devices, you might still be able to access M365 resources via a browser.
